In the 1990s, key fobs were popularized. They let you unlock, arm, and secure your alarm by pressing a button. They come with a plastic case and buttons powered by batteries. They can also open your trunk and turn on the ignition. Certain models require a metal key to be inserted in the ignition.

Some fobs can be programmed by a "self-programming" process. It is different for each vehicle, but usually involves pressing buttons to open and close the doors within a specific time frame. You can find these instructions in your owner's guide or by contacting your dealership.

In some instances the manufacturer of your car might require that the new fob is programmed by the dealer. This is because the dealer has specific equipment to ensure that the new key fob is associated with your vehicle. This service can be costly and not covered under your warranty.

A dead battery can cause your key fob to lose its connection to your vehicle. In this case, you will have to replace the battery and get it reset by a locksmith to ensure that it can work with your car once more.

Key fobs communicate via low-frequency radio waves to an antenna that is located within the car's latch. The signals transmit a code that matches the receiver's code. This allows the car to recognize the key and unlock the door after it has been inserted.
